The international factors and the Kosovo institutions still have not managed to persuade Serbs to participate in the Elections of 23rd October. The OSCE Mission in Kosovo, which has left open the possibility to the Serbs to be pronounced until 1st October, still has not got any positive signals whether members of this community will participate in the Assembly Elections. This was confirmed also by the OSCE HoM Pascal Fieschi following his meeting with the Kosovo Assembly speaker Nexhat Daci. Nevertheless, Ambassador Fieschi expressed the hope that the Serbs will respond positively to the appeals for participation in the Elections.

Ambassador Fieschi said, "We are waiting for positive signals, and we are optimistic that it will happen, so that they can participate in the Elections, too."
The Assembly speaker Daci appreciated the role and assistance given by the OSCE in democratization of life in Kosovo, and pointed out the need of deepening the collaboration in the future.
Mr. Daci said, "We think that the OSCE in Kosovo should be powerful; the Assembly considers that the OSCE should be like in all normal countries, because it has the capacities to help both the Assembly and democracy.
The OSCE HoM, the Ambassador Pascal Fieschi said that the OSCE will continue to support democratic Kosovo institutions in the future.
EU High Representative for Foreign and Security Policy, Javier Solana said today that the Serb minority should participate in the elections because this is in their best interest. "The participation of Kosovo Serbs in the elections will be of benefit for them. They will have to be engaged in the processes, which will start with these elections and continue," said Solana in a joint press conference with UNMIK Chief, Soren Jessen Petersen.
